An electric throw blanket is a heated blanket designed for personal use that provides adjustable warmth through built-in electric heating elements, usually controlled by a hand remote or digitally. In simple terms, it’s a cosy, heated layer you can snuggle under on couches, chairs, or beds to stay warm during cool evenings or chilly seasons. The main reason Australians love electric throw blankets is that they combine practical warmth with stylish home comfort, making them a must-have for winters in southern states and cooler nights nationwide.

How to Choose an Electric Throw Blanket
Choosing the right electric throw blanket comes down to material, safety, heat settings, size and styling:
1. Material & Feel
-
Fleece: Soft, quick-warming and budget-friendly
-
Sherpa/Plush: Extra cosy, ideal for cooler climates
-
Wool blends: Stylish and naturally insulating
2. Safety Features
Look for blankets with:
-
Auto shut-off timers
-
Overheat protection
-
Quick disconnect cords
Safety matters most, so choose blankets certified for Australian electrical standards.
3. Heat Settings & Controls
-
Multiple heat levels (low, medium, high)
-
Remote or in-line controllers for ease
-
Some digital units offer timers and memory settings

Benefits & Use Cases of Electric Throw Blankets
Warmth & Comfort
Provides targeted warmth — ideal for reading nooks, chilly lounges, or bedroom relaxation.
Energy Efficiency
More economical than heating entire rooms — perfect for cosy evenings without costly energy bills.
Pain Relief & Relaxation
Warmth improves circulation and helps with muscle tension — great after a long day.
Enhances Home Comfort
Layered over couches or beds, electric throws invite rest and relaxation.
Great for Shared Spaces
Larger throws keep partners or family members warm together without zone conflict.
Seasonal Versatility
While best in cooler months, many Australians enjoy them year-round for chilled mornings or air-conditioned evenings.
